准备Linux系统面试的你,是否漏掉了这些关键问题?

常见的Linux命令

熟悉Linux日常使用的命令是面试中的基础。面试官常常会询问一些基本的命令,例如 ls 用于列出目录内容,cd 用于切换目录,以及 cp 和 mv 用于文件的复制和移动。这些看似简单的命令,实际上在面试中是评价一个人Linux能力的基石。

权限管理

在Linux中,权限管理是一个非常重要的课题。面试官通常会询问关于文件和目录权限的问题,您需要清楚地解释如何使用 chmod、chown 和 chgrp 等命令来管理权限。理解不同的权限(读、写、执行)以及如何设置它们的组合,将为您在面试中提供额外的优势。图片[1]-准备Linux系统面试的你,是否漏掉了这些关键问题?-SEO论坛-分享经验-东莞市快语信息咨询有限公司

服务与进程管理

Linux系统通常作为服务器使用,进程和服务的管理也常常是面试的重点。您需要了解如何使用 ps、top、systemctl 等命令来管理系统进程和服务。能够快速找到正在运行的服务,查看它们的状态,以及如何启动或停止服务。

文件系统结构

了解Linux的文件系统结构也是必不可少的。面试官可能会询问根目录(/)、用户目录(/home)、临时目录(/tmp) 及其它特殊目录的用途。能清晰地描述这些目录的作用和使用场景,表明您对Linux系统的基本了解。图片[2]-准备Linux系统面试的你,是否漏掉了这些关键问题?-SEO论坛-分享经验-东莞市快语信息咨询有限公司

脚本编写

面试中也可能会问到脚本编写,尤其是Shell脚本。您需要展示如何编写一个简单的脚本以自动化某些任务。面试官可能会要求您解释脚本中的变量、循环和条件语句,甚至是如何处理输入和输出。

网络配置与管理

在Linux环境下,网络配置是一个重要的话题。您可能会被问到如何配置IP地址、检查网络连接或使用工具如 ping、netstat 和 ifconfig。解释网络层次和协议的基本知识,以及如何解决连接问题,将显示出您的技能水平。

系统日志与监控

了解Linux系统的日志文件及其使用也是面试关注的重点。您需要熟悉 /var/log 目录下的日志文件,以及如何查看和分析这些日志,可以帮助您在面试中展示您的问题解决能力。

安全性与防火墙

安全性问题在Linux系统中至关重要。面试官可能会询问您如何配置防火墙(如使用 iptables 或 firewalld)和其他安全措施。深入了解Linux的安全特性将使您更具竞争力。

源码管理与版本控制

在团队开发中,源码管理工具(如Git)也是常见话题。理解如何在Linux上使用Git进行版本控制、克隆和合并等操作,将在面试中显著提升您的表现。

持续集成与部署

如今,许多企业使用CI/CD工具来提升开发效率。了解如何在Linux环境下使用这些工具(如Jenkins、Travis CI等)并解释其工作流程,将展示您对现代软件开发的了解。

© 版权声明
THE END
喜欢就支持一下吧
点赞6 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容